The visible laser diode is a laser having center wavelengths ranging from 404 nanometers to 690 nanometers, and in which diodes are set concerning wavelength and then power. However, UV laser diodes typically range in wavelength from 200 nm to 389 nm and have exceptionally high photon energies. The visible and UV laser diodes are used in lithography, medicine, micromachining, cleaning, and semiconductor processing. The main products of visible and UV laser diodes are single-mode and multi-mode. Single mode is a laser diode that has a single light-emitting region, only one laser diode per package, and an output power range for single mode laser diodes starting at mWs. The doping materials such as, AlGaInP, GaN, and InGaN are used in the preparation of laser diodes, which are used in industrial, defense, scientific, medical, and other applications.

Major companies operating in the visible and UV laser diode market are focused on developing advanced products such as Deep Ultraviolet (Deep UV) lasers to gain competitive advantage. Deep Ultraviolet (Deep UV) lasers are devices that emit light in the short-wavelength range of approximately 100 to 400 nanometers. For instance, in January 2023, IPG Photonics Corporation, a US-based company specializing in fiber laser technology, introduced three advanced Deep Ultraviolet (Deep UV) lasers featuring proprietary non-linear crystals. These lasers offer enhanced reliability and flexibility compared to conventional frequency conversion materials, catering to various industries and micromachining applications. The product lineup includes a 3-watt continuous wave, single-frequency fiber laser at 266 nm for applications such as inspection and spectroscopy, a 5-watt nanosecond pulsed fiber laser at 266 nm for precision tasks on challenging materials, and a 5-watt picosecond pulsed fiber laser at 257 nm designed for micro-cutting and drilling in applications such as PCBs and flat panel displays.What Are Latest Mergers And Acquisitions In The Visible And UV Laser Diode Market?
In January 2023, TOPTICA Photonics AG, a Germany-based laser manufacturer, acquired a majority stake in Azurlight Systems SAS, for an undisclosed amount. With this acquisition, TOPTICA aims to strengthen its European presence and accelerate the development of high-performance fiber laser solutions by integrating Azurlight’s expertise in low-noise amplifiers and tunable diode lasers into its product portfolio. Azurlight Systems is a France-based fibre technology company that offers visible and UV laser diode.Regional Outlook
